Noise at all grind settings [DF64] by Ok_Swimming9905 in espresso

[–]arw_86 5 points6 points  (0 children)

Yeah sorry, missed that.

It's what the retailer said. It's small pieces of bean getting caught. There's small tolerances between burrs/burr carrier/housing and small fragments can get lodged.

Just ignore the sound until you finish your full dose, then bellow or adjust collar and it usually stops. Even if it doesn't stop it doesn't matter, just turn it off.

As it seasons it will get less, but still occasionally happens. There's no damage happening just a little annoying at times I guess. Although doesn't bother me personally.

How important is even distribution/saturation for flavor and consistency? by SomethinSaved in espresso

[–]arw_86 3 points4 points  (0 children)

The puck is responsible for the distribution and saturation. Hence why puck preparation is important. There's no pressure here as there's no puck to create it. So really, how it looks here is not important. The amount of water that you see will quickly fill the gap between grouphead and puck and create pressure.
